In 1784, Christian Greig entered the world in Moffat, Dumfries-shire, Scotland, born to David Greig And Elizabeth Haig. In 1841, Christian Greig resided in Fife, Scotland. Christian Greig married Robert Mccullock, and had children including Janet Nichol Mccullock. Christian Greig passed away in 1844 in Edinburgh, Midlothian, Scotland.
